Overview of Duke University Hospital:
Duke University Hospital, located in Durham, North Carolina, is the largest of our three hospitals, featuring 1048 patient beds and 65 operating rooms. We offer comprehensive diagnostic and therapeutic services, including a regional emergency/trauma center and an endo-surgery center.

Position Overview:
The Clinical Nurse II position in the Intensive Care Nursery involves caring for critically ill newborns. Our Special Care Nursery and Intensive Care Nursery together provide care for over 1000 infants annually, including those with complex medical conditions.

Responsibilities:
As a Clinical Nurse II, you will:
1. Deliver professional nursing care in accordance with established policies and procedures.
2.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to ensure comprehensive care for patients.
3. Utilize nursing judgment to tailor care plans based on patient assessments.
4. Supervise and delegate tasks to other nursing staff.
5. Participate in professional development and performance improvement initiatives.

Work Schedule:
This is a full-time position with rotating shifts, requiring a minimum of 2-4 weekend shifts per month.
